February leads for comfortable weather in Haikou: typically 23.1°C by day, 17.1°C at night, with 35 mm of rain. Based on measured 1991–2020 NOAA station history.

The weakest month is July, scoring 5 against February’s 90 — 294 mm of rain falls, and days average 33.4°C, 9° above the 24°C the score treats as ideal.
Month by month
The bars show the comfort score. Day and night temperatures come from daily observed highs and lows; rain is the historical monthly estimate.
| Month | Day | Night | Rain | Wet days | Sea | Daylight | Comfort | Coverage |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| January | 21.3°C | 15.8°C | 26 mm | 4.4 | 19.8°C | 11 h 02 | 88 | Good coverage |
| February | 23.1°C | 17.1°C | 35 mm | 6.1 | 19.3°C | 11 h 28 | 90 | Strong coverage |
| March | 26.5°C | 19.7°C | 49 mm | 6.2 | 20.5°C | 11 h 59 | 78 | Good coverage |
| April | 30.1°C | 22.9°C | 83 mm | 7.1 | 22.9°C | 12 h 35 | 55 | Good coverage |
| May | 32.3°C | 24.9°C | 214 mm | 13.1 | 26.2°C | 13 h 04 | 21 | Good coverage |
| June | 33.5°C | 25.8°C | 243 mm | 14 | 27.9°C | 13 h 20 | 10 | Good coverage |
| July | 33.4°C | 25.8°C | 294 mm | 14 | 28.5°C | 13 h 14 | 5 | Good coverage |
| August | 32.4°C | 25.6°C | 293 mm | 12.9 | 28.4°C | 12 h 49 | 8 | Good coverage |
| September | 31°C | 24.9°C | 291 mm | 12.2 | 28.1°C | 12 h 14 | 15 | Good coverage |
| October | 28.9°C | 23.5°C | 308 mm | 8.6 | 27.2°C | 11 h 39 | 25 | Good coverage |
| November | 26°C | 20.8°C | 63 mm | 6.2 | 25.0°C | 11 h 10 | 76 | Good coverage |
| December | 22.4°C | 17.6°C | 43 mm | 5.7 | 22.1°C | 10 h 55 | 87 | Strong coverage |

| Month | Warm & dry days | Wet days | Washouts | Week with 3+ wet days | Daytime mean has ranged |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| January | 55% | 15% | 2% | 18% | 18.8–23.4°C |
| February | 60% | 23% | 3% | 26% | 19.7–25.4°C |
| March | 74% | 20% | 5% | 20% | 23.7–29.0°C |
| April | 75% | 25% | 9% | 30% | 27.6–32.1°C |
| May | 60% | 41% | 18% | 56% | 30.7–34.0°C |
| June | 58% | 43% | 21% | 59% | 31.8–34.4°C |
| July | 63% | 38% | 19% | 49% | 32.1–34.5°C |
| August | 61% | 40% | 20% | 52% | 31.3–33.2°C |
| September | 60% | 40% | 22% | 52% | 29.8–31.8°C |
| October | 71% | 30% | 16% | 34% | 27.2–29.7°C |
| November | 78% | 21% | 7% | 21% | 23.8–27.2°C |
| December | 68% | 15% | 4% | 15% | 20.1–24.0°C |
A warm and dry day reaches 20°C with under 1 mm of rain; a wet day gets 1 mm or more; a washout gets 10 mm or more. The week column is the share of seven-day stretches in that month, across the station’s whole daily record, that contained three or more wet days — the odds a week-long trip is rained on repeatedly, counted rather than modelled. The last column is the 10th to 90th percentile of that month’s daytime average across individual years: a narrow band means the average is what you will get, a wide one means the average is a midpoint between years that felt quite different.
